This is lesson 1 of 13 in the unit "Circuits, Current, and Creativity". Lesson Title: Electricity Vocabulary Launch Lesson Description: Introduce and illustrate voltage, current, resistance, electron flow, conductor, insulator, switch, LED, motor, and battery. Students begin a vocabulary page using the uploaded circuit diagrams. Emphasize that electron flow moves from the negative terminal toward the positive terminal in a closed circuit. (CCSS: RST.6-8.4, SL.7.1)
In this first lesson of the 13-part unit Circuits, Current, and Creativity, students build a shared vocabulary for describing simple circuits. They use circuit diagrams and component images to connect each term to a visual model, while establishing that electron flow travels from the negative terminal toward the positive terminal through a closed circuit.

0–5 min · Hook and notice. Teacher displays the opening circuit image showing a battery, switch, LED, and motor and asks, “What must be true for the LED to light?” Students silently notice details, make a prediction, then share one observation with a partner.
5–12 min · Build the vocabulary. Teacher uses the vocabulary introduction slides to introduce voltage, current, resistance, electron flow, conductor, insulator, switch, LED, motor, and battery; give a student-friendly definition, gesture, and circuit example for each. Students record a brief definition and sketch or symbol for each term on the circuit vocabulary page.

12–20 min · Diagram investigation. Teacher models one uploaded circuit diagram, thinking aloud while identifying the battery, wires, switch, LED, and motor, then traces electron flow with a finger from the negative terminal to the positive terminal. Students annotate the diagrams on the circuit vocabulary page, labeling components and drawing directional arrows. Teacher emphasizes that a gap creates an open circuit, so electrons cannot complete the path.
20–29 min · Partner matching and discussion. Teacher gives pairs a set of the circuit symbol and component cards and instructs them to match each component image, symbol, label, and description, then choose four cards to explain to another pair. Students use the frames “The ___ is important because ___” and “Electron flow moves from ___ to ___.” Teacher listens for confusion between voltage, current, and electron flow.
29–35 min · Apply and correct. Teacher presents three diagrams on the diagram challenge slides: a closed circuit, an open-switch circuit, and a circuit with a reversed LED. Students independently identify whether electrons can complete a path, mark the electron-flow direction, and justify one answer with vocabulary. Partners compare responses before the teacher facilitates a brief correction.
35–40 min · Review and exit ticket. Teacher returns to the final review and exit-ticket prompt and asks students to complete the final section of the circuit vocabulary page: define one term, label a component, and explain what happens when a switch opens. Students submit the page as they leave and share one word they expect to use in the next lesson.
